Marlins open conference play with sweep at Guilford

GREENBSORO, N.C. -- Virginia Wesleyan College's softball Marlins opened the Old Dominion Athletic Conference portion of its schedule on Saturday with a sweep of the Guilford College Quakers, 8-0 and 6-1.

Sophomore pitcher Kristina Karagiorgis (Ashburn/Briar Woods) recorded the pitching win in the shutout, improving to 5-2 on the season.  She struck out three batters, walked four and scattered six hits. 

In the second game junior Mackenzie Creech (Hillsborough, N.C./Orange) was the winning pitcher for the Marlins, improving her record to 6-2.  She faced 27 batters, fanned six and gave up six hits and one earned run.

Virginia Wesleyan (14-4, 2-0) trailed only once in the doubleheader, and that was at the start of the second game.  Guilford (9-5, 0-4) took the lead with a run in the bottom of the first inning when Cynthia Hayes (Seagrove, N.C./Southwestern Randolph) belted a home run.

But, Virginia Wesleyan got that run back, and more, in the top of the third inning when junior Tori Higginbotham (Glen Allen/J.R. Tucker) homered to center field.  She drove in rookie Hali Goad (Richmond/Louisa County) who led off the inning by reaching base when she was hit by a pitch.

The Marlins pulled away with a three-run fifth inning, helped by four hits, including a Karagiorgis double.  The inning included a walk, a batter hit by a pitch, a wild pitch and two stolen bases.

Virginia Wesleyan outhit the Quakers 8-6, led by junior Season Dailey (Norfolk/Virginia Beach Frank W. Cox) and rookie Courtney Bogan (Round Hill/Woodgrove) with two hits each.

Morgan Myers (Winston-Salem, N.C./Parkland) started in the pitching circle for Guilford.  She pitched 4.1 innings before giving way to Calli Pastor (Newburg, Pa./Big Spring).  They struck out one batter each.

Casey Snead (Ellerbe, N.C./Richmond Senior) was the starting pitcher for the Quakers in the opener, working 2.2 innings.  Maggie Shaffer (Horsham, Pa./Hatboro-Horsham) finished.  The duo combined to strike out seven batters, five by Shaffer.

Allie Nicholson (Lexington, N.C./North Davidson) and Hayes led Guilford hitting with two each.  Junior Andrea Shannon (Newville, Pa./Big Spring), Dailey and Karagiorgis connected for a double each for VWC.

Virginia Wesleyan returns to competition Wednesday, March 20, playing in an ODAC doubleheader at Sweet Briar College beginning at 3 p.m.
